The product is a hardcover book titled "New York in the War of the Rebellion 1861-1865 3rd Edition Volume 1" by Frederick Phisterer. It was published by the New York State publisher in Albany, New York in 1909. The book is a historical military and war text focusing on the Civil War. It is a valuable collectible piece for those interested in American military history and the events of the Civil War.


The book has 896 pages and measures 8.5"x11"x2.5". This is Volume 1 out of 6 and was produced as a part of a required state reports.


This six-volume set, compiled by Frederick Phisterer, provides detailed information on various aspects of New York State's role in the Civil War and is an important resource for conducting research into New York State regiments during the Civil War.  Each regimental history in this set includes information on when and where a regiment was recruited, the names of its officers, the battles in which the regiment participated, and the casualties suffered.
